Comments

Type locality, Teluk Sebakor, Fak Fak Peninsula, Papua Barat Province, NCIP 6332 (holotype of Chrysiptera giti. 3.6 cm SL, male). Known only from two Indonesian locations, in the vicinity of Sebakor Bay on the southern coast of the Fak Fak Peninsula of western New Guinea and the Togean Islands off northeastern Sulawesi. Observed to be common at both the Togean Islands and in Sebakor Bay, but generally replaced by C. hemicyanea in other parts of the Fak Fak Peninsula (Ref. 74966).
